Instructions to investors provide guidance and information on the obligations and steps investors must follow when participating in a particular investment opportunity.
Individuals or entities that are involved in raising capital or managing investments typically required to file instructions to investors include investment firms and fund managers.
To fill out instructions to investors, one should provide accurate details concerning the investment, including the terms, risks, and necessary disclosures as per the regulatory requirements, ensuring all relevant information is included.
The purpose is to ensure that investors are fully informed about the investment opportunities, including associated risks and responsibilities, aiding them in making educated investment decisions.
Information that must be reported includes investment terms, risk factors, fees, redemption policies, and any other disclosures required by law.
